免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

如何制作电脑exe软件

制作电脑exe软件,需要掌握一定的编程知识和工具使用技巧。在这里,我们将介绍电脑exe软件的制作原理和详细步骤,帮助初学者更好地了解和掌握制作电脑exe软件的方法。

一、电脑exe软件的制作原理

电脑exe软件是运行在Windows操作系统上的可执行程序,它可以直接在电脑上运行,不需要任何额外的解释器或虚拟机。电脑exe软件通常是用高级编程语言编写的,例如C、C++、Java等,然后通过编译器将源代码转换为机器码,最终生成可执行文件。

在制作电脑exe软件时,需要掌握以下基本原理:

1. 编写源代码:首先需要根据软件的需求,使用编程语言编写源代码,实现软件的功能。

2. 编译代码:编写完源代码后,需要使用编译器将源代码转换为机器码,生成可执行文件。

3. 调试程序:在生成可执行文件前,需要进行调试程序,确保程序的正确性和稳定性。

4. 打包发布:最后将可执行文件打包为安装程序,并发布到用户手中。

二、电脑exe软件的制作步骤

1. 确定软件需求

在制作电脑exe软件前,首先需要确定软件的需求,包括软件的功能、用户群体、操作系统等。这些基本要素将直接影响到软件的开发和制作。

2. 选择编程语言

根据软件的需求和开发人员的技能水平,选择适合的编程语言。常见的编程语言有C、C++、Java、Python等。

3. 编写源代码

根据软件的需求,使用编程语言编写源代码,实现软件的功能。需要注意的是,源代码应该尽可能简洁、规范、易于维护。

4. 编译代码

使用编译器将源代码转换为机器码,生成可执行文件。不同的编程语言和编译器有不同的操作方式,需要根据具体的情况进行操作。

5. 调试程序

在生成可执行文件前,需要进行调试程序,确保程序的正确性和稳定性。需要注意的是,调试程序是一个反复试错的过程,需要有耐心和细心。

6. 打包发布

最后将可执行文件打包为安装程序,并发布到用户手中。安装程序可以包含软件的说明、使用方法、版权信息等,使用户更好地了解和使用软件。

三、制作电脑exe软件需要掌握的技能

1. 编程语言:需要掌握一种或多种编程语言,例如C、C++、Java等。

2. 编译器:需要掌握使用编译器将源代码转换为机器码的方法。

3. 调试工具:需要掌握使用调试工具进行程序调试的方法。

4. 安装程序打包工具:需要掌握使用安装程序打包工具将可执行文件打包为安装程序的方法。

5. 操作系统知识:需要了解不同操作系统的特点和差异,以便编写兼容性较好的软件。

总之,制作电脑exe软件需要一定的编程知识和技能,需要耐心和细心,才能制作出高质量的软件。希望本文能够帮助初学者更好地了解和掌握制作电脑exe软件的方法。


相关知识:
exe怎样做组合图
EXE,扩展名为可执行文件(.exe)的程序,实际上本问题中的问题应该是想问如何用某种图像处理软件制作组合图。这里,我们以Photoshop为例进行详细介绍。组合图是将多张图片合并成一张的方法,可以是在一个相框内显示多个照片,也可以是将多个元素融合在一起创
2023-04-27
c语言做成exe
在这篇文章中,我们将介绍如何将C语言源代码编译为可执行的exe文件,以及相关的原理和详细步骤。C语言是一种广泛使用的编程语言,有着强大的功能和广泛的应用领域。编译过程包括预处理、编译、汇编和链接等多个阶段。一、原理1. 预处理:预处理器读取源代码文件,处理
2023-04-27
app打包生成exe
在本教程中,我们将介绍应用程序(App)打包生成可执行文件(.exe)的原理和详细步骤。打包生成EXE文件的目的是让用户能直接双击运行应用程序,而无需事先安装编程语言或编译环境。以下主要针对Windows平台进行讲解,分为两部分:原理说明和详细操作步骤。#
2023-04-27
快应用开发
快应用是一种轻量级应用开发框架,由中国移动、华为、小米、OPPO、VIVO等手机厂商共同推出。快应用具有启动速度快、占用空间小、无需安装等特点,可以为用户提供更加便捷的应用使用体验。下面我们就来介绍一下快应用的开发原理和详细介绍。一、开发原理快应用的开发原
2023-04-14
如何开发exe程序
EXE程序是一种可以在Windows操作系统上运行的可执行程序。它是由程序员编写的计算机程序,经过编译后生成的二进制文件。本文将详细介绍EXE程序的开发原理和步骤。一、开发EXE程序的原理EXE程序的开发过程可以分为两个主要阶段:编写源代码和编译源代码。在
2023-04-14
多应用打包系统
多应用打包系统是一种将多个应用程序打包成一个统一应用的技术。这种技术主要应用于移动应用领域,可以大大简化用户的操作,提高用户的使用体验。在本文中,我们将详细介绍多应用打包系统的原理和实现方式。一、多应用打包系统的原理多应用打包系统的原理非常简单,就是将多个
2023-04-14
windows批量exe文件
Windows批量exe文件是一种能够将多个可执行文件同时执行的方法。通过批处理文件,用户可以在一次操作中运行多个应用程序或命令。在Windows操作系统中,批处理文件使用BAT或CMD文件扩展名。本文将详细介绍批量exe文件的原理和使用方法。一、批量ex
2023-04-14
web可以打包exe吗
Web应用程序是一种基于互联网的应用程序,它们运行在Web服务器上,可以通过Web浏览器来访问。与传统的桌面应用程序不同,Web应用程序不需要安装和下载,用户只需通过浏览器访问即可。然而,有时候我们需要将Web应用程序打包成可执行文件,以便于在没有网络连接
2023-04-14
tp6创建应用
TP6是一个基于PHP的Web开发框架,使用它可以快速地创建出高效、安全、可扩展的Web应用程序。在本文中,我们将详细介绍如何使用TP6创建一个Web应用程序。1. 安装TP6首先,我们需要在本地环境中安装TP6。TP6可以通过Composer进行安装,我
2023-04-14
mac软件用什么开发
Mac 软件开发是指在 macOS 系统下开发各种软件的过程。macOS 系统是一款基于 Unix 的操作系统,使用 Objective-C 和 Swift 作为主要的编程语言。下面将详细介绍 Mac 软件开发的原理和流程。一、开发工具1. XcodeXc
2023-04-14
lightly生成exe
Lightly是一个Python库,可以将Python脚本打包成可执行文件。这个工具非常实用,可以让我们将Python代码方便地分享给其他人,而不需要他们安装Python环境。本文将介绍如何使用Lightly将Python脚本打包成可执行文件,并解释其背后
2023-04-14
exe网页程序
EXE网页程序是指将网页文件打包成一个可执行的程序,用户下载后可以直接运行,无需安装浏览器或其他插件,即可访问网页内容。这种程序通常是由网页设计师或开发人员使用特定的软件工具制作而成,具有一定的技术门槛。EXE网页程序的原理是将网页文件(HTML、CSS、
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4